The act of acquiring audio content encoded at a 320 kbps bitrate from the SoundCloud platform signifies the retrieval of a higher-quality audio file compared to lower bitrate alternatives. This process typically involves utilizing third-party applications or websites designed to extract the audio stream from SoundCloud’s servers. For instance, a user may employ a specific tool to save a favored track from a particular artist in a format ensuring optimal sonic fidelity.
Obtaining audio files at this enhanced quality level is advantageous for listeners prioritizing a richer and more detailed auditory experience. The higher bitrate generally translates to a more complete reproduction of the original recording, minimizing data compression artifacts that can detract from the sound.
